Army comparison: Canada vs France

Overview

France's army fields 6,633 active vehicles — 3.9x Canada's 1,690. Additionally, Canada has 0 and France has 184 vehicles in storage.

The breakdown includes 74 vs 222 tanks, 616 vs 627 infantry fighting vehicles, 290 vs 2,599 armored personnel carriers, 0 vs 74 self-propelled artillery, 154 vs 74 towed artillery, 0 vs 9 rocket launchers (Canada vs France).
